  • Patent number: 5036204
    Abstract: Circularly polarized monochromatic electromagnetic radiation of a wavelength correlating the maximum absorbance of a sample compound is directed through a flowing solution containing the sample compound, which exhibits circular dichroism activity, and a plurality of other compounds. Measurement of the circular dichroism effect and comparison of an alternating current signal corresponding to the circular dichroism absorption to a direct current component allows for the constant monitoring of the concentration of the sample compound in the flowing solution. The flowing solution may be under high temperature and pressure and may comprise a supercritical fluid.
